This zine is an adaptation of the poplar Japanese folk tale of the Kuchisakke-Onna,
or “Slit-Mouthed Woman.” It takes the original tale and adds in a few extra high
school students to give an anti-bullying message as well as retaining the horror of 
the original story. Keeping with the story’s culture of origin, the zine is drawn in a 
heavily manga-inspired style but keeps the western-style of reading left to right.
